If you've ever used the desktop version of ArtRage, you'll feel quite at home working in the iPad version, and you can even exchange files between the platforms.
Version 1.3 of ArtRage for iPad brings Facebook, DropBox and deviantArt upload support, new PNG and JPEG export options, canvas rotation, a simplified gallery, and more. In addition, you can now record your paint strokes and play them back in the Windows or Mac versions of ArtRage 3.5. When you replay your artwork in the desktop app, you can create a higher resolution file.
